Transaction fb60efb56b0c5efda642b4db2f754f838c0207f26c01caf7a99572cbb3303f61
1 Input
1 Output
-
fb60efb56b0c5efda642b4db2f754f838c0207f26c01caf7a99572cbb3303f61:0
- value
- 8831559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3fded8ae3c47a2fa9561438b62635403409710a OP_EQUAL
- address
- 3Ge8G2oj7LTH5nsKSaxL4rCPsLSG4QGmk2